Martin Wiedmann, Ph.D., D.V.M., is the Gellert Family Professor of Food Safety at Cornell University. He received a veterinary degree and a doctorate in Veterinary Medicine from the Ludwig Maximilians University in Munich, and a Ph.D. in Food Science from Cornell. His research interests focus on farm-to-table microbial food quality and food safety, as well as the application of molecular tools and quantitative and modeling approaches to study the transmission of foodborne pathogens and spoilage organisms. He and his team are regularly asked to help industry across the world with a range of microbial food safety and quality challenges, including reviews of testing methods and testing plans. He also serves on the food safety advisory councils of different food manufacturers.
